A recent change in util-linux removed its unconditional dependency on pam.
You can see the commit here:
https://src.fedoraproject.org/rpms/util-linux/c/56f4756f3ac033f9cc7b2be94847a3cb38ad8da1

This change affects Mock and Copr users, who frequently work with minimal
installations (e.g., buildroots that do not include systemd).  As a result,
/bin/su no longer works by default in Mock, which contradicts the expectations
of many users (even though they are probably not really building RPMs in Mock).
